发明名称 PIPE JOINING BODY, TREATMENT TOOL, AND JOINING METHOD
摘要 Provided is a pipe joining body in which a wire rod and a tubular member are joined. The wire rod includes a concave portion formed by plastically deforming a part of an outer periphery of the wire rod. The tubular member includes a deformed portion that is formed so as to enter the concave portion by inserting the wire rod into the tubular member and by pressing a portion of the tubular member covering the concave portion toward the concave portion to plastically deform the portion. A maximum displacement amount of the tubular member when the deformed portion is formed is not larger than a maximum displacement amount of the wire rod by the plastic deformation when the concave portion is formed. The concave portion is formed by bringing a mold having a convex surface into contact with the part of the outer periphery of the wire rod to press.

主权项 1. A pipe joining body in which a wire rod and a tubular member are joined, wherein: the wire rod includes at least one concave portion formed by plastically deforming a part of an outer periphery of the wire rod; the tubular member includes at least one deformed portion that is formed so as to enter the at least one concave portion by inserting the wire rod into the tubular member and by pressing a portion of the tubular member covering the at least one concave portion from an outer periphery of the tubular member toward the at least one concave portion to plastically deform the portion; a maximum displacement amount of the tubular member when the deformed portion is formed is not larger than a maximum displacement amount of the wire rod by the plastic deformation when the concave portion is formed; the at least one concave portion is formed by bringing a transfer mold having a convex transfer surface into contact with the part of the outer periphery of the wire rod to press; and the at least one deformed portion is formed by bringing a transfer mold having a transfer surface of a same shape as that used for the wire rod, into contact with the outer periphery of the tubular member to press.
